Battery Replacement
Your Lexus key fob is an ultra-sophisticated piece of technology that enables you to lock and unlock your vehicle doors, as well as turn on the ignition with a push button, all without having to take your keys out of your pocket or purse. This advanced device could be damaged due to daily use or exposure to the elements. A replacement battery is needed.
It's simple to change the battery on your Lexus Key Fob from the comfort of your Cabo-Rojo home. Press the release button on the back of your key fob in order to remove the emergency blade. Then put the flathead tip of a screwdriver inside the same space and press it gently to break the key fob cover plate off. Make sure you wrap the tip of your screwdriver in tape prior to attempting this step, as it's possible that the plastic will scratch or break. After you have removed the cover plate, you are able to insert a CR2032 with the "+ side" facing upwards.

Programming
In addition to unlocking and locking your car, key fobs now have the ability to do a variety of things, like roll down your windows or summon it when you're in a congested parking space. This can make replacing a fob that's lost or damaged costly, especially if you have a luxury vehicle such as one like a Lexus.
A dealer or locksmith will replace your key fob at costs ranging from $50-$75. With a little expertise and a bit of time you can change the key fob battery by yourself.
The process of programming the replacement Lexus transponder key or remote involves telling the car's computer that the new fob is authorized to start the engine. This is done by connecting a special programing machine, which is usually available at the dealer.
You can buy a new remote or an alternative key fob at many hardware stores, big box retailers, and even online. You can also find a lot of YouTube videos from people explaining how to perform the task. The instructions are usually very straightforward, but depending on the model and year, you may need to do some research. For instance, some Lexus fobs are encrypted, which means that they require a second key to unlock the doors and then start the engine. If you have an old-fashioned transponder key, you'll only need to cut it and programmed to function.

The best advice for Lexus owners is to keep the key fob clear from electronic devices such as laptops and TVs that produce magnetic fields. These devices can interfere with the fob, and cause it to run out of battery quickly.
It's simple to replace the battery in your Lexus key fob if you have the correct tools. You'll also require a flat head screwdriver as well as a new lithium battery. The best kind of battery to use is a CR2032 lithium cell. These batteries are available in stores that sell digital cameras, electronic appliances and some grocery chains.
After replacing the battery, you'll need to replace the cap and insert the mechanical key into the fob. Then put the cap back on and revel in the fact that you now have a functioning Lexus key fob again.
